摘 要
摘 要:为了解决河西内陆灌区制种玉米田有机质含量低,土壤板结,贮水性能差的问题,在甘肃省张掖市甘州区沙井镇古城村连续种植制种玉米10年的基地上,采用田间试验方法,研究了抗旱性专用肥对土壤理化性质和玉米经济效益的影响。结果表明:抗旱性专用肥施用量与土壤孔隙度、团聚体、持水量、有机质、速效氮磷钾和玉米穗粒数、穗粒重、百粒重、产量呈正相关关系,与土壤容重呈负相关关系。随着抗旱性专用肥施肥量梯度的增加,玉米产量在增加,而边际产量、边际产值和边际利润在递减,,边际利润出现负值。经回归统计分析,抗旱性专用肥施用量与玉米产量间的肥料效应回归方程为:y=++,。
关键词:抗旱性专用肥;土壤理化性质;玉米;经济效益
